If you’re craving a crunchy and savoury snack, tôm rang muối is the answer ! It literally translates to Roasted Salted Shrimp, but is more commonly found on the Google under the title “Salt and Pepper shrimps”. What is it? It is a crunchy bite size delight, coated in a flavourful salty seasoning, which makes it the perfect afternoon companion. Also, tôm rang muối is surprisingly quite easy to make! So salty snack it is today. Let’s get to work :

👉 Tom Rang Muoi recipe ingredients :

THE SEASONING :
*note : this creates waaaayyy much seasoning than you need. Only add to your taste to the shrimps, and keep the rest for rainy days
– 1 teaspoon of peppercorn (black or white)
– 3/4 teaspoon of salt
– 1/2 teaspoon of paprika
– pinch of chili flakes
– 1/2 teaspoon of ginger powder
– 1/2 teaspoon of chicken powder stock

THE REST:
– 12 medium size shrimps with head and tail
– vegetable oil
– 1 cup of cornstarch
– 2 garlic cloves
– green onions
– coriander to your taste
– shrimp crackers
